Dedhua Gram Panchayat, Sikty

Dedhua is a Gram Panchayat located in the Araria district of Bihar. It falls under the Sikty Panchayat Samiti and Araria Zila Parishad. Dedhua Gram Panchayat covers a total of 4 villages, including Bairgachhi, Bhaptia, and Darhua. It is headed by an elected Mukhiya, while administrative work is handled by the Panchayat Sachiv.

List of Villages in Dedhua Gram Panchayat

Dedhua Gram Panchayat covers the following villages.

Sl. No.Village
1Bairgachhi
2Bhaptia
3Darhua
4Sohagmara

Panchayati Raj Structure for Dedhua Gram Panchayat

Dedhua Gram Panchayat is part of Bihar's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.

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)

Dedhua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.

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)

Sikty Panchayat Samiti is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Dedhua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.

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)

Araria Zila Parishad is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Dedhua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
